My guest this week, Jonathan Weiland, started out at community college to explore what he liked. Then he enrolled in Illinois Tech and figured out in his post-graduation roles that he wanted to work behind the scenes.
He’s a great example of trying something and deciphering what was and wasn’t a good fit. Then making the change. That’s the important distinction.
Jonathan’s advice:
- Be open and honest with your manager about your strengths; they’re more than likely to be receptive to you.
- Doing a good job is just the beginning; let them know what you’ve earned and learned, then what you would like to pursue.
- Always go into new opportunities with an open mind.
- Be a good listener and don’t be afraid to ask questions.
Most often, employers will do anything to keep you if they think you’re a valuable employee. So prove it!
Who knows? They may just even create a new role for you.
